LOCATION
The property is situated in Doi Saket district on the edge of the village of Mae Pong and just north of Chiang Mai city center. There are a few shops in the village in addition to a daily market and a larger weekly market at the temple. There are also several other markets on various days within a few minutes drive. Doi Saket is a small town adjacent to the Hwy 118 which goes north to Chiang Rai. This unhurried little town offers various shops including several smaller supermarkets, banks, post office and a hospital.
Mae Pong is a very peaceful rural farming community which offers a very laid back lifestyle yet it also allows you easy access to Chiang Mai and the International Airport. There is a small international expat community spread throughout the district.

UTILITIES
3 Phase electricity is installed at the property. There are 3 wells on the land. 1 well is at the far end of the property adjacent to Villa 5 and 1 well is adjacent to the small cooking school. These wells are used for watering the grounds and filling the ponds. The large pond has the capability of easily being filled or emptied depending on the season. The main well which is approximately 75m deep, is located to the front of the property. Bedside this, is the enclosed water treatment plant which provides high pressure treated water to all of the property. Each building has individual ecological bio septic tank waste systems (7 in total) which require virtually no maintenance. Waste is collected weekly at a approx. cost of 240 Baht per year.
